Cypress Hills MLA Wayne Elhard

With healthcare staffing challenges in the Southwest, and especially in Shaunavon, Cypress Hills MLA Wayne Elhard took considerable interest in one part of the recent provincial cabinet shuffle.

Biggar MLA Randy Weekes was appointed the new minister responsible for rural and remote health, and Elhard made immediate contact.

"I phoned Randy Weekes to offer him congratulations on his new appointment, and indicated to him that he had a big task facing him, and given my own experience with rural healthcare isues, I would be happy to offer him assistance and advice at any level." Elhard said. "We need to find ways that we can provide appropriate healthcare for these smaller communities in outlying areas of the province. They may not look exactly like healthcare delivery in the past, but we have to find ways but we have to find ways that will provide appropriate levels of care for today and into the future."

Shaunavon Hospital in particular has faced numerous disruptions due to physician and nursing shortages, including one overnight. They are set for another one from Thursday evening into Friday morning.
